Bug description:
  Since kernel 3.0, upstream has disabled audio output for all ATI cards
  in the Radeon driver by default.

  === Workaround 1 ===

  Edit /etc/default/grub and change this line:

  G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T="quiet splash"

  to this line

  G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T="quiet splash radeon.audio=1"

  Now run "sudo update-grub", then reboot your computer.

  === Or workaround 2 ===

  Install the proprietary Catalyst driver.

  ===

  There's no sound at all and videos playback in fast forward when
  outputting through the HDMI controller. This is a regression since it
  worked well in previous releases.

@sergiodavies - You seem to have four DisplayPort monitors connected.
If this is the case, you have a different bug.  Nevertheless, I can
advise here that support for DisplayPort audio on AMD Radeon hardware is
finally available in the upstream Linux 4.0 kernel.

A PPA of the 4.0-rc2 kernel is available at http://kernel.ubuntu.com
/~kernel-ppa/mainline/ and instructions on how to install and uninstall
it are at https://wiki.ubuntu.com/Kernel/MainlineBuilds
